#c69f06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c69f06 is composed of 77.6% red, 62.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 97%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 40%. #c69f06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#8d3f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c69f06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c69f06 has RGB values of R:198, G:159,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.97,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13016838.

Shades and Tints of #c69f06
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080600 is the darkest color, while #fffc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c69f06
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686764 is the less saturated color, while #c69f06 is the most saturated one.
